ABINGDON and Witney College has submitted plans to expand its dance studio.

A design and access statement submitted with the application to Vale of White Horse District said the college's Abingdon campus needed the upgrade to keep up with demand.

If approved, the plan would mean removing the current single dance studio with a double one to avoid 'overcrowding'.

A design and access statement submitted with the application stated: "The second dance classroom is now an essential requirement to enable effective delivery of the curriculum.

"It will enable different genres and dance class activities to be simultaneously taught as opposed to the current scenario where there is only one classroom hence limiting the activities and tasks that can be set for students at any one point in time."

A public consultation is currently open on the scheme and comments can be submitted via whitehorsedc.gov.uk until May 23.
